**Ticket: PUBAPI-412 — Signature check failing on paginated responses**

For the eng sync: the Wrenfold public API started rejecting page 2+ of `/orders` after last night's deploy. Looks like the cursor token gets re-signed with the old key mid-pagination. Quick fix is redeploying the verifier with the rotated key:

release key, kaweg-yageg: bky9_zjV8qYyup

- [ ] Step 7: Archive cold storage buckets (Glacierline tier). Confirm both ceremony witnesses are present, verify bucket manifests match the Oxbow ledger, then seal the archive key shares. Plugin authors may observe but not handle shares. Once sealed, the archive index itself is encrypted and can only be reopened with the passphrase below.

vault phrase of badup-hahig = tamael-aldael-kelmir-istael-fenok-istwyn-tamius-jorath-oliion

Off-site run checklist — item 7, spare parts for the Dunmoor Ridge relay station. Records team: confirm the crate of replacement actuators and gasket kits from Harlenvale Supply is logged against the site manifest before loading. Photograph seals, record crate weight, and file the packing slip in the run folder. The courier collects at 09:00 from bay two. The confidential hand-over instruction follows:

dispatch memo: the lamwyn fenwyn courier leaves the wenir ledger at gate 7175 under passcode 822969

Heads up on the validator plugin loader in Quillbasin CI: if a third-party validator fails to register, the whole suite silently skips instead of erroring. Fix in this PR makes registration failures fatal and logs the offending plugin name. Please double-check the manifest parsing change — it's a bit hairy. Repro runs reference the build token below.

session token of bawep-yadup = htk21_528abd376e3c5a4ec24a1

## Further reading

New to Ravelin's tracing setup? Start with how trace IDs propagate through the Orchardgate gateway, then skim the span naming conventions — seriously, skim them, reviewers will nitpick. The sampling config is the part that bites most newcomers. We've collected the full guide, diagrams, and a worked example on our internal docs page here:

wiki page, fajof-tajef: https://vault.tolvaqio.corp/board/pipeline/pages/ticket/c20d7f984bcc9e12